Celebrate 4th of July in San Diego!

There are so many options for watching the Fourth of July fireworks in San Diego!!! The beaches will be crowded as everyone takes in the sun and sand for a day of relaxation and fireworks. Get there early if you want a spot.

San Diego Fireworks

San Diego Fireworks

Find the best location to watch the July 4th displays in your area:

San Diego’s “Big Bay Boom” fireworks (Embarcadero) [Map]
The biggest event in San Diego! Fireworks at 9:00 p.m. at the Port of San Diego. You get a whopping 16-1/2 minutes of displays and it will be televised on Fox 5 HD and Cox 4 HD. This is a very well attended display, so carpool and come early!

Attractions:

Fourth of July at Sea World [Map]
Celebrating the entire weekend, Sea World lights up the sky with its tower and a brilliant fireworks display.

Legoland’s Red, White and Boom [Map]
Take the family to Legoland for an Independence Day treat.

San Diego County Fair Fourth of July [Map]
Head over to the Del Mar Fairgrounds for rides and fun and stay for the fireworks display!

Cities:

Camp Pendleton [Map]
Del Mar Beach Fireworks at 9:00 p.m. The Beach Bash has activities all day with music, food and games. Live bands start at 12 p.m.

Coronado [Map]
Coronado launches their fireworks at 9 p.m. The day starts at 7am with things do for everyone. Hang out all day for the half-marathon, rough water swim, Art in the Park and live music in the park.

Escondido [Map]
Catch the fireworks in Escondido’s Grape Day Park.

La Jolla Cove [Map]
Fireworks start at 9 p.m. You can watch from Scripps Park, La Jolla Cove, and La Jolla Shores Beach.

Julian [Map]
Enjoy a small town parade nestled in San Diego’s apple country.

Lake Murray [Map]
Head out to Lake Murray for Music Fest! Fireworks start at 9:15 p.m. Three bands perform throughout the day: Pullman Standard: 12:00-1:00 p.m & 1:30- 2:30 p.m., The Surf City All Stars: 3:00 – 5:30 p.m., Rockola: 6:00-9:00 p.m.

Mira Mesa Recreation Center [Map]
Fireworks start at 9:00 p.m. Parade begins at noon including: food, rides, games and entertainment at Mira Mesa Community Park.

Ocean Beach Pier [Map]
Fireworks start at 9 p.m. Turn your radios to Radio SOPHIE 103.7 for a live simulcast.

Poway [Map]
At the Poway High School Stadium the fun starts at 7:00! Fireworks start at 9 p.m.

Rancho Bernardo [Map]
Fireworks at 9:00 p.m. The Annual Rancho Bernardo Spirit of the 4th Festival & Parade runs from 7:00 a.m.- 9:30 p.m.

San Marcos [Map]
At William R. Bradley Park. Fireworks at 9:30 p.m.

Vista [Map]
Visit Brengle Terrace Park for food, live entertainment and more!! Fireworks start at 9 p.m.
